Block 508,060
Block Hash
e9a1bcbb7988e6b9fb0640a4a04d766de48757f1779f7a41b59b3ca3bf78e48a
Previous Block Hash
81fd9a08eefbdca7497830ad68a6174d64c6e56bfa2f0a426dd1df5324e292bd
Mined
Transactions
3
Difficulty
53.48 M
Size
2,493 bytes
Transactions (3)
1 input, 1 output
15,625.0233
PEPE
13 inputs, 2 outputs
14,825,143.16734538
PEPE
1 input, 5 outputs
46,726.36748069
PEPE